PSLEWinnie received $84 from her father each month for her pocket money. The line graph shows the amount of pocket money she spent each month.
- What is the difference between the amounts Winnie spent in Dec and in Mar?
- Write down all the months in which Winnie spent more than half her pocket money. Give the answer in short form. (Eg Jan, Mar)
(a)
Amount that Winnie spent in Nov = $29
Amount that Winnie spent in Dec = $49
Amount that Winnie spent in Jan = $58
Amount that Winnie spent in Feb = $25
Amount that Winnie spent in Mar = $30
Difference between the amounts Winnie spent in Dec and Mar
= 49 - 30
= $19
(b)
Half of Winnie's monthly pocket money
= 84 ÷ 2
= $42
Months in which Winnie spent more than half her pocket money: Dec, Jan
Answer(s): (a) $19; (b) Dec, Jan
